基本能力
产品定位
MCP for Security 是一个专为安全工具设计的 Model Context Protocol (MCP) 服务器集合,旨在通过 AI 能力增强安全测试和渗透测试工作流。
核心功能
- 集成流行工具:支持 SQLMap、FFUF、NMAP、Masscan 等安全工具。
- AI 工作流支持:通过 AI 辅助流程增强安全测试。
- 模块化架构:易于添加或修改新工具的服务器。
- 用户友好接口:简单的命令即可快速上手。
- 活跃社区:参与讨论并贡献于持续开发。
适用场景
- 安全测试
- 渗透测试
- AI 辅助的安全工作流
工具列表
- SQLMap:自动化 SQL 注入和数据库接管工具。
- FFUF:快速的 Web 模糊测试工具,用于目录/文件发现。
- NMAP:网络探索工具和安全/端口扫描器。
- Masscan:互联网规模的端口扫描器。
常见问题解答
- 如何贡献?请参考
CONTRIBUTING.md
文件。 - 如何联系支持?通过电子邮件 support@mcp-for-security.com 或 Twitter @MCPforSecurity。
使用教程
使用依赖
- 克隆仓库:
bash
git clone https://github.com/StanLeyJ03/mcp-for-security.git
cd mcp-for-security - 安装依赖:
bash
pip install -r requirements.txt
安装教程
- 下载最新版本:从 Releases section 下载并执行文件。
调试方式
- 启动服务器:
bash
python server.py - 连接工具:
bash
./connect_tool.sh <tool_name> - 开始测试:
bash
./run_test.sh <parameters>